Transaction 780d735831b073ee6e19d9955fd663a12282f4878e5e9bf978e53e53d977f642

2 Input
2 Outputs
  • 780d735831b073ee6e19d9955fd663a12282f4878e5e9bf978e53e53d977f642:0
  • value  25000000
    address  1Q1WT43BjADKuC5Jc5hYumfEypBy2uNhse
  • 780d735831b073ee6e19d9955fd663a12282f4878e5e9bf978e53e53d977f642:1
  • value  2871773
    address  3FpYdtEimMXCpHo3YPKRT4mqZnxx3YTgdb